Ir al contenido principal

Clase #1 (IIP) Arduino y pines digitales

Para empezar la clase hicimos estos tres retos, con los nuevos grupos armados para el segundo parcial. 

1. Conectar leds en serie a 1 solo pin del Arduino (la cantidad máxima)

2. Conectar el buzzer a un pin digital del Arduino 

3. Conectar el pulsador a un pin digital del Arduino
 

En la siguiente clase revisamos algunas conexiones de otros grupos y la conexión de la profesora y nos dimos cuenta que los leds estaban mal conectados ya que debían estar en serie. También trabajamos en el código para hacer parpadear los leds y también hicimos una programación del buzzer y pulsador en grupos. Al final observamos una conexión con su programación y la miss fue corrigiendo algunas partes. 

Logros:

Logramos conectar todos los componentes necesarios. Al principio nos demoramos un poco en el primer reto pero pudimos conectar siete leds y se encendieron. Los otros retos se cumplieron rápidamente, así que por esta clase culminamos los tres retos.

Dificultades:

Se nos dificultó un poco al terminar la programación ya que no estábamos seguros de como hacer el código. También tenemos que trabajar en la comunicación dentro del grupo para terminar más rápido y poder compartir más ideas.

¿Qué me pregunto?

Me pregunto que otras conexiones haremos para el proyecto cuando empezamos a hacer la programación.

En la siguiente clase también trabajamos en el código para hacerlo funcionar y aumentamos una resistencia en la conexión ya que era necesaria.

Para que sirve...

Serial.begin: Para iniciar la comunicación serial con Monitor en Serie.
Serial.println: Sirve para escribir datos en el puesto serial.
digitalRead: Se usa para leer el valor de un pin digital.

La resistencia que después conectamos al pulsador sirvió para que la placa Arduino pueda hallar el voltaje que va directo a la resistencia y lo pueda reconocer al presionar el pulsador.





Comentarios

Entradas populares de este blog

Sistemas de un robot

Sistema de control: El sistema de control en un robot es como el sistema nervioso en un ser humano, esto es un conjunto de componentes y circuitos eléctricos. La pieza más importante del sistema de controles es el procesador, esto le indica al robot como debe hacer las cosas, también podemos programar los robots para que hagan lo que nosotros les digamos a través de el procesador para que mande al resto del cuerpo del robot lo que hay que hacer. Sistema eléctrico: El sistema eléctrico es el que se encarga de almacenar y enviar energía eléctrica a los componentes eléctricos que lo necesiten. Los materiales que el sistema eléctrico contiene son las baterías y el cableado eléctrico, es una parte muy importante de un robot ya que siempre necesita energía. Sistema mecánico:  El sistema mecánico es la máquina que permite el movimiento de el robot. Esto contiene motores y articulaciones, tiene piezas auxiliares como los tubos y ruedas. Para armar un robot podemos usar materiales pl...

Práctica L239D

En esta clase hicimos una copia de un circuito que la profesora había hecho. Después conectamos cables al Arduino del protoboard y también usamos el L239D como se visualiza en la imagen. Después, hicimos la parte de programación para que los motores se muevan; hicimos que los motores se muevan a izquierda y derecha, arriba y abajo.   He aprendido cómo programar y conectar los cables para que el circuito funcione, ya que si un cable no está bien conectado, no servirá lo demás. Aprendí gracias a la participación de mis compañeros, y la explicación de la profesora, junto con la demostración. Una dificultad que tuve es que al principio se me fue el internet y cuando volví, no sabía que estábamos haciendo pero después ya me pude poner al día. También, no entendía muy bien había que hacer la programación pero al hacer la primera, ya entendí las demás.

Carrito evita obstáculos

 En estas clases empezamos el nuevo parcial con un nuevo grupo. Mi grupo es Scarlett, Bianca y yo. Empezamos una conexión con un sensor ultrasónico y motores a Arduino. También usamos un puente L293D, para lo que hicimos una conexión parecida a la que hicimos en el parcial pasado. Por lo tanto también hicimos una programación parecida a la actividad pasada ya que uno de los objetivos era que sea como un carrito y que si el sensor ultrasónico detecta un objeto, el carrito retroceda. Para eso también se usan los motores. Trabajamos en grupo para completar el trabajo. Hicimos la conexión en base a la conexión pasada y también la programación, simplemente fue un poco diferente.  ¿Qué y cómo aprendí? Aprendí como hacer la conexión y programación con Arduino y el puente. Esto lo aprendí mediante la explicación de la profesora y la plataforma Tinkercad. ¿Cuáles fueron sus dificultades y como las superó? Una dificultad era que al principio la líder no compartía pantalla y también otra...